What is this?! Why it’s a recipe for a goopey marshmallow spread! Super sticky and gooey, bright white and surprisingly simple – marshmallow fluff can totally be made at home. I like to swirl it into ice cream, add to sweet sandwiches, and even drizzle into milkshakes! This recipe makes A LOT of fluff, so feel free to cut it in half if you don’t use it too often!
2 cups light corn syrup
3 egg whites
2 ½ cups powdered sugar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Pinch of salt
In a large mixing bowl using an electric mixer on high, beat the egg whites with the corn syrup for 5 minutes (or until thick). Add in the powdered sugar, vanilla, and salt. Continue beating until everything is incorporated and thick.
